On a domain if you have to install client software that requires a bat file to install due to its complexity. What is the best method of installing the software via scripts. The only option I can think of is to give all the users temporary administrator rights during the installation. Which of course is not ideal.
 
So you would have an administrator password in plain text in a bat file instead of giving all users domain admins. The other alternative is going to each pc individually and installing it manually as admin. One other one i thought of was setting domain admin rights during the day and then sending an email to everyone before and telling them that they will have a scheduled restart and then set admin rights and at the end of the script remove them.
 
I tried to run it as a start up script on a gpo with a computer ou and it did not work.

When i tried to add a domain user as a local admin on a pc and run the bat file came up with access denied messages. I am not sure if i could make a msi out of that.
